Daily “core protocols” (10, from Huberman’s book Protocols)

1) Get sunlight / bright light early

  • Aim for bright light in the first ~60 minutes of waking
    • Natural sunlight preferred; ~10,000 lux daylight substitutes if needed.
  • Rationale: supports a healthy cortisol rhythm (higher in the morning, lower in the evening/night), improving:
    • Mood, focus, learning, sleep quality
    • Immune function
    • Metabolism
  • Practical notes:
    • If sun isn’t available: use 10,000-lux light
    • If you miss a day: get outside longer the next day
    • Avoid UV overexposure/sunburn; low solar angle typically means lower UV risk

2) Hydrate first

  • 16–32 oz (≈500–1000 ml) soon after waking (electrolytes optional).
  • Goal: sharper mind + supports morning physiology, including the cortisol awakening response.

3) Reduce stress fast (real-time tools)

  • Use physiological sigh / long exhale breathing to downshift arousal quickly and improve heart-rate variability (HRV).
  • Mentioned options:
    • 10 long deliberate exhales when stressed, especially before/after high-arousal moments
    • Other formats discussed: box breathing, meditation, etc.
  • Why: a calmer physiological state supports clearer thinking and better learning/performance.

4) Exercise early + near-challenge effort

  • Weights for ~45 minutes, with sets close to failure
    • Discussed as creating a desired cortisol “inflection” when timed early.
  • Example structure (as described):
    • Alternate lifting/cardio on different days
    • Lifting:
      • Compound movements
      • 2–3 work sets per exercise
      • Warm up first
    • Cardio examples:
      • Long slow (~1 hour)
      • Moderate (~30 min)
      • Plus a short high-intensity bike session (e.g., intervals)
  • Morning is often better for rhythm entrainment, but late-day exercise still helps.

5) Workout “principle”: deliberate discomfort builds tenacity

  • Training improves the ability to stay engaged with hard things by strengthening brain systems tied to persistence/tenacity.
  • Examples: resistance training, cold-water training, and other challenging practices.

6) Use light timing at the end of the day

  • Late-day goal: get daylight in the last third of your day (especially indoors).
  • Helps buffer the negative impact of artificial light at night and may protect:
    • Melatonin
    • Blood glucose rhythms
  • Youth/adolescents: late-night screens can strongly disrupt cortisol/glucose dynamics, even if teens feel they sleep fine.

7) Limit bright light/cortisol at night

  • Keep the bedroom dark (eye mask recommended; earplugs optional).
  • Dim lights in the evening; avoid screens close to bed when possible.
  • Suggestion given:
    • No screens in the last ~30 minutes before sleep
    • First ~30 minutes after waking: look at sun/bright light (plus hydrate/move)

8) Sleep positioning

  • Sleep on your side (slightly elevated head mentioned) to support glymphatic clearance and potentially:
    • Help with morning “puffiness/bags”
    • Reduce dementia risk (as discussed)

9) Use “midnight wake-up” techniques

  • If you wake during the night:
    • Long exhale breathing
    • A “wacky but effective” technique: guided eye movements with eyes closed + a long exhale, to reduce body-position attention and help you fall back asleep.

10) Mental performance & learning protocols

  • Effortful learning about hard material daily (implied minimum: something that feels like “a fight”).
  • Key learning method: self-testing
    • Retrieval practice improves long-term retention more than re-reading.
  • Focus environment tip:
    • Remove your phone from the room (even without notifications), since the brain anticipates the possibility of being reached.

Metabolic health & productivity-through-energy

  • Walking after meals
    • Target: ~5–10 minutes after eating to flatten glucose peaks and reduce energy crashes.
  • General movement
    • Step goal mentioned: ~7,000–8,000 steps/day (directional, not rigid)
    • Prefer stairs, walking during calls, movement while traveling, etc.

Nutrition highlights (as described)

  • High “complete protein to calorie ratio”
    • Emphasize lean protein sources (e.g., eggs, lean meat, fish) rather than needing huge calorie volumes.
  • Fiber & fermented foods
    • Emphasize vegetables/fruit for micronutrients + fiber, but not “more is always better.”
    • Low-sugar fermented foods mentioned: sauerkraut, kimchi, beet kvass.
  • Starches can support sleep
    • Carbs/starches can help buffer cortisol at night and reduce “survival-driven” hunger/shaking.
    • Avoid eating right up against bedtime; don’t chase gnawing hunger.

Supplements (only selectively, “behavior-first” framing)

  • Emphasis: foundation behaviors first (light, exercise, hydration, sleep, nutrition), then supplements if needed.
  • Examples of supplements discussed:
    • Magnesium (e.g., glycinate or threonate/bisglycinate) for sleep
    • Omega-3 (EPA) (suggested ~1g/day EPA; prescription Lovaza mentioned for purity)
    • Vitamin D (commonly 5,000–10,000 IU/day mentioned; avoid excessive dosing)
    • Alpha-GPC (focus/choline; caveat: possible TMAO increase mitigated with garlic)
    • Creatine (cognitive enhancement, especially when stressed/sleep deprived)
